Key Features of Energy-Efficient Windows
Energy-efficient windows are equipped with specialized coatings and materials that enhance their performance. Some key features include:
- Low-E Glass: This refers to glass that has a special coating to reflect infrared light, keeping heat inside during winter and outside during summer.
- Gas Fills: Argon or krypton gas is used between panes to provide better insulation than air.
- Warm Edge Spacers: These reduce heat transfer and condensation at the edges of the glass.

Improved Comfort and Indoor Air Quality
Energy-efficient windows not only help in reducing costs but also improve the comfort of your home. They minimize drafts and cold spots, maintaining a consistent indoor temperature. Additionally, certain window coatings can block UV rays, protecting furniture and flooring from sun damage while also minimizing glare.
